Capture the cozy essence of fall with frosted maple cookies, packed with the rich sweetness of pure maple syrup and topped with a creamy frosting. Perfect for any autumn occasion, these soft, chewy treats bring warmth and flavor to your gatherings or quiet afternoons by the fire. • 2 1/4 cups all purpose flour • 1 tsp baking soda • 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on • 1/2 tsp salt • 1 cup light brown sugar • 1/2 cup unsalted butter room temperature • 1/2 cup pure maple syrup • 1 egg large • 1 tsp vanilla extract
